Shanghai law enforcement authorities have initiated the city's first-ever criminal prosecution targeting the unauthorized leaking of video game content. The case centers on an individual accused of illegally obtaining and disseminating confidential pre-release materials from a domestic game company.
According to official reports, the suspect allegedly procured unreleased character designs, skill descriptions, and narrative details. This material was then edited into multiple short videos and published across various online platforms, accruing significant viewership and generating substantial revenue through platform incentives.
The leaks reportedly caused severe damage to the game developer's planned marketing strategy and overall operational timeline. Investigators stated that the suspect admitted to being aware of the illicit nature of the content. In a statement, he revealed he believed that deleting the videos after receiving warnings would allow him to avoid legal consequences, highlighting a misconception about the seriousness of such intellectual property violations.
This landmark prosecution signals a hardening stance against leaks within China's lucrative gaming industry. Legal experts suggest the case will serve as a stark warning, emphasizing that unauthorized disclosure of trade secrets and copyrighted materials is not merely a civil matter but can lead to serious criminal charges. The outcome is being closely watched as it may set a precedent for how similar breaches are handled nationwide.
